Motorola Moto G84 is just a bit better than the Nokia 8 Sirocco, with an 80.9 score against 74.2. Nokia 8 Sirocco features a much more powerful processor than Motorola Moto G84, although it has 6 GB lesser RAM memory, they both have the same number of cores. The Motorola Moto G84 has a little sharper screen than Nokia 8 Sirocco, because although it has a bit lower quantity of pixels per inch in the display and a bit worse resolution of 1080 x 2400, it also counts with a bigger screen.
Moto G84 counts with a lot better camera than Nokia 8 Sirocco, because although it has a smaller diafragm aperture which is worse for low light photos and video, and they both have the same video frame rate and the same video definition, the Moto G84 also counts with a back camera with a much higher 50 mega-pixels resolution and a lot bigger sensor providing a lot higher image quality.
Moto G84 counts with slightly more storage for applications, games, photos and videos than Nokia 8 Sirocco, because although it has no SD memory card expansion slot, it also counts with more internal storage. Moto G84 features a way better battery life than Nokia 8 Sirocco, because it has a 53 percent greater battery capacity.
